About the role
Enlighten is seeking an experienced Training/Documentation Manager to support operations and assist in growth strategy, with a focus on defense and government agencies. This role involves developing and overseeing markdown-based training content, web-based modules, instructional vignettes, hands-on instructor-led training materials, technical user documentation, and contractual deliverables to ensure successful capability rollout and satisfaction of programmatic requirements.
